区块链与网络安全:它们到底有什么关系?
区块链是什么?
区块链,这个词最近可是在各大社交平台上炸开了锅。你可以把区块链想象成一本大账本,所有人都能看到,所有的交易记录都在里面。这些记录是以“区块”的形式存在,并且一旦写入,就很难修改。简单来说,它是一种去中心化的技术,没有人能单独控制它。
这就引出了一个区块链的去中心化究竟跟网络安全有什么关系呢?大家都会担心,数据在网络上到底安全吗?是啊,谁不想把自己的隐私保护好呢?我们来进一步聊聊。
网络安全的基石
网络安全,顾名思义,就是我们在互联网上进行各种活动时,如何保护自己的信息不被窃取。比如,网上购物、社交账号、甚至连你的电子邮件。如果这些信息被黑客偷了,可能会产生很大的麻烦。
这时候,区块链就像一个超级护卫队。因为每一个区块都包含着之前区块的信息,形成了一条链。只要有一个区块被篡改,整条链就会失效。所以,想要在区块链上胡来可不是件容易的事。
简化的例子让你更明白
我记得有一次和朋友在讨论这个话题时,他用一个比喻让我恍然大悟。他说:“想象一下,你和朋友一起把秘密写在一个本子上,这个本子在你们之间传来传去,大家都可以在上面写下新的内容但不能删掉已写的。就算有一个人在中间偷偷改动了某个内容,其他人只要查看之前的内容就能发现。”
这就是区块链的工作原理!通过透明性和共识机制,大家都能保证信息的安全。更重要的是,这个本子没办法被谁单独掌控,大家都是平等的。
区块链保护我们的数据方式
我们可以从几个方面来看区块链如何保护数据安全。
- 去中心化:传统的数据库往往是中心化的,这就容易被攻击。比如,某个公司数据库被黑客攻破,所有用户的信息就会泄露。但在区块链中,没有中心化的存储,数据分布在许多节点上,就算一个节点被攻击,也没有办法影响整个网络。
- 不可篡改:数据一旦写入区块链,想要修改几乎是不可能的。因为每个区块都与前一个区块相连,如果想改动,就得重写所有后面的区块,这在计算上几乎是不可能的。
- 透明性:虽然交易记录是公开的,但参与者的身份却是匿名的。所以,无论何时,数据都是可追溯的,任何不合法的行为都能被发现。
- 智能合约:有些区块链技术(如以太坊)支持智能合约,这是一种自动执行合约条款的技术。当特定条件满足时,合约会自动执行,无需人干预,这减少了人为错误和欺诈的可能性。
但是区块链还是有其局限性
当然,区块链也不是万无一失,比如,它并不能解决所有网络安全问题。比如,即便区块链本身是安全的,但如果用户的密码或私钥被盗,那怎么也没办法保护你的资产。这样的问题也是让人无奈的。
再来就是网络的延迟和处理速度。尤其是在比特币等公链中,交易确认可能需要一定时间,这对于某些即时交易的场景来说就显得不够理想了。因此,虽然技术在不断发展,想要完全替代传统网络还是有很长的路要走。
未来的网络安全:区块链有何角色
未来,区块链技术可能会在网络安全领域扮演越来越重要的角色。世界上很多企业开始尝试将区块链应用于身份验证、防止数据篡改等领域。比如,有些公司已经开始把员工数据记录在区块链上,这样就能保证数据的安全性和透明性。
我自己也在思考,如果有一天,我的个人数据都可以在区块链上管理,那我的隐私安全吗?我觉得会更安全一些,因为这就像是把我的数据锁在一个虚拟的保险柜里,只有我有钥匙。但是这把钥匙我一定要好好保管,不能随便给别人。否则,保险柜再好,钥匙一丢,一切就没了。
总结一下
所以说,区块链在网络安全上有着不可忽视的优势。它的去中心化、不可篡改、透明等特性都为我们保护网络安全提供了新方向。不过,这一切仍然需要我们每个人的参与和重视。保护个人的隐私更是我们每个人的责任和义务。
说到这里,不知道你对区块链和网络安全有什么新的想法呢?也许将来我们会在生活中越来越多地见到这项技术,保护我们的网络安全。如果有任何问题,欢迎随时和我讨论!